[open] When Using canvas in OpenSeseame,what is the central coordinate(x,y value) of the screen.

Hi Guys.

I want display fixation dots around central points with some amount of distance.
But I could not find what is exact central coordinate of the screen.
It seems like somewhere x=500~600 y=300~400
Or is it depend on what kind of monitor that I am using?
Then, how can I find it?

    Hi Seo,

    It depends on which version of Opensesame you are running. In OS 3.0.x, it is quite simple. Here, the middle is always (0,0) (unless the option Uniform coordinates is disabled). In older versions of Opensesame (2.9.x and older), the center of the canvas depends on the size of the window you are using. Nevertheless, finding the center is rather easy with the commands canvas.xcenter() and canvas.ycenter(), see here.

    I hope this helps.
